Facebook account issues are rendering some Oculus Quest 2 headsets unusable – PC Gamer UK
A Facebook account is required to use the Oculus Quest 2, and that is causing headaches for some people.

Imagine being banned from an online service (through no fault of your own) that is required to use a new $300+ piece of hardware you just bought. Unfortunately, some early adopters of the Oculus Quest 2 don’t need to have a vivid imagination, because they’re living through the frustrating experience right at this very moment.
